Piano Prep/Piano Conservatory Program

About the Program

The ASU Piano Prep Program offers quality piano instruction to children - elementary through high school - in a creative and highly motivating learning environment. Since its inception in 1988, the program has provided students with opportunities for excellent musical instruction from experienced model teachers and highly selected ASU graduate students. Jan Meyer Thompson, founding director and professor of music, coordinates the program, linking teachers and piano prep students with university piano pedagogy courses in a lab school setting. Piano Prep Program students enjoy a well-planned and varied curriculum emphasizing the development of musicianship skills through individual and group piano study and performance. School of Music piano studios, digital piano labs and recital halls provide the finest facilities for instruction and performance.

Approximately 85 students from the metropolitan area are enrolled annually in two phases of the program. The two program types are:

Piano Prep Program
A seven-year elementary to intermediate level core program combining weekly individual piano lessons (40 or 50 minutes) with weekly, semi-monthly or monthly group lessons (45 or 60 minutes). Varied performance opportunities. Group lessons take place in digital piano labs with multiple keyboards. Children range in age from 6 to 14.

Piano Conservatory Program
A program of late intermediate to advanced study for continuing junior high and high school students. Weekly 60-minute lessons, studio performance classes and a variety of recital opportunities are offered.

Tuition for each academic year is payable in four installments.

Audition interviews are held in April and August for fall enrollment.
